ABSTRACT:
An cable assembly includes an insulative housing; a plurality of signal terminals and grounding terminals received in the insulative housing; a plurality of signals wires and grounding wires; a grounding member having a main portion located in a vertical plane and a plurality of fingers projecting forwardly therefrom, the main portion defining positioning cavities separated from each other; the signal wires held in the positioning cavities, with conductors of the signal wires electrically connected to the signal terminals, the grounding wires electrically connected to the grounding member and the fingers of the grounding member electrically connected to the grounding terminals.
